Transaction e666fb9e8690a433cbc28fec951891e2f42f53e7bbc25fa0e99c612722510cf2
1 Input
1 Output
-
e666fb9e8690a433cbc28fec951891e2f42f53e7bbc25fa0e99c612722510cf2:0
- value
- 388289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 544ccc588b6ddb9ccc54f512fa6b095587f66020 OP_EQUAL
- address
- 39Nkgh5UzC2nbJtQyBjr5uVCV2nw1Xomyu